Barn sta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to wooden barn structures, helping to preserve the wood and enhance its appearance. This service is suitable for various projects, including restoring weathered exteriors, sealing new or existing barns, and maintaining the structural integrity of large wooden buildings.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of stains available, such as transparent, semi-transparent, or solid finishes, and how these options can impact the look and durability of their barn. Additionally, considerations around the best timing for staining and preparation steps are common questions before requesting service.
Before requesting barn staining, property owners should consider the condition of the wood, including any signs of rot, mold, or damage that may need addressing beforehand. It’s also important to understand the local climate and how it can influence the choice of stain and application timing.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ning or sanding, is often necessary to ensure the stain adheres properly and lasts longer.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ations for protection, appearance, and longevity.

Barn Staining Questions
What types of surfaces can be stained? Barn staining services typically cover wooden barn exteriors, doors, and fences to enhance appearance and protection.
How often should a barn be stained? It is generally recommended to stain a barn every 3 to 5 years to maintain its condition and appearance.
What finishes are available for barn staining? Various finishes are available, including transparent, semi-transparent, and solid stains, to achieve different aesthetic and protective effects.
Is barn staining suitable for all wood types? Barn staining can be applied to most common wood types used in barns, helping to preserve and beautify the material.
